The Planning Board approved several architectural design-review sign applications on July 16, including a revised freestanding sign at 15 Green Street, a freestanding sign at North State Street for Pierce Mance, and non-illuminated building signs for 32 North Main Street, with conditions on illumination and design details.

The Concord City Planning Board on July 16 approved several architectural design-review applications for new and replacement business signs, and clarified conditions about illumination, mounting and operational panels. Signarama, representing Home in Hand, won approval to replace an existing 10-square-foot freestanding sign at 15 Green Street using the existing posts, after the applicant revised on-site posts and submitted updated plans.
